Organisms that are closely related usually have very similar chromosomes numbers and a large degree of homology (similarity) beween their chromosomes (but the chromosomes are different enough to maintain genetic isolation).
Scientists mainly compare similarities and differences in what the organisms look like. With the less obvious relations, they analyze their DNA. The goal is to find a common ancestor between the two organisms. The more recently that ancestor existed, the more closely related the organisms are.
The knowledge of DNA makes for more accurate classification of organisms because the scientists can examine certain species of organisms and see if there are related or closely related to determine weather or not they can be classified in the same group or not.
Biologists classify organisms into various groups or categories. This enables scientists to organize the millions of kind so of living things based on shared characteristics and to help in the identification of newly discovered organisms. If an organism shares many traits in common with another, the two organisms will be classified or categorized as belonging to the same group. The more closely related two organisms seem to be, the more taxa they will have in common. In this way, scientists can begin to understand the evolutionary relationship of organisms. Classifying organisms also makes naming organisms simpler: due to language and cultural differences, it may be confusing for scientists from around the world who were studying organisms if each organism had a unique name in each country. Classifying organisms within an understood set of rules allows scientists to discuss specific organisms with less confusion.
